my cycle is over. he will come back in a few years he always does. i don't believe in meds either. this cycle i used o2, changed my diet, stayed away from beer,  took some kudzo and a few other natural things that grow in the dark. if a drug company cures your problem then they loose a customer. think about how much trex costs.
